| Vista Business/Home Premium/Ultimate x64/Server 2008 X64 | Re: x64 ultimate install from x64 home premium cd and ultimate 32 key SparlyGuy...if you had a disk that read Vista Home Basic you could install Vista Ultimate with it if you had a Ultimate key. All versions are on the DVD. Except there are 32bit and 64bit DVDs. The keys work with both. |
